Mark M: An online figure drawing session

Lizet Dingemans

For this figure drawing session, join Lizet Dingemans as she captures model Mark with flesh-coloured pastel pencils on toned paper. She will explore ways to bring out the natural variations in skin tone, adding depth and realism through careful shading and layering. Lizet is using burnt sienna, sanguine, beige red, and white pastel pencils, but any flesh toned ones will do.
